Wiktionary examples

These source excerpts show how disintegrating appears in context. They illustrate usage; the definition above remains the entry’s reference meaning.

  1. "By means of the purple disintegrating rays, the site to be used later for agricultural purposes is treated exactly as is the canal proper."
  2. The city did not evolve up from the ground, it descended from Heaven; the me's, the divine laws which constitute the program for civilization, were carried by Inanna from the seat of Enki at Eridu to her beloved Erech (Uruk); without these divine laws, no city can hold together, no wall can stand against the disintegrating wind of the desert.
